Where to Exercise Caution

While this design has many strengths, no machine embroidery design is universal. As an experienced creator, I must highlight areas where Valentine s Day Border with Red Heart requires careful consideration to avoid customer dissatisfaction.

First, avoid using this design on highly textured fabrics like heavy terry cloth towels unless you are using a substantial stabilizer. The texture can distort the delicate lines of the heart border, leading to a messy finish. Similarly, stretchy baby clothes require a strong tear-away or cut-away stabilizer to prevent puckering. If the fabric stretches during stitching, the border will warp, ruining the symmetry.

Another critical factor is scale. Do not attempt to downsize this design too much. Small lettering or tiny details within the border may become indistinguishable if the hoop size is reduced excessively. Always check the minimum recommended hoop size provided by the designer. Furthermore, dark fabrics pose a challenge for standard thread colors. If you are stitching on black or navy fabric, ensure you have high-contrast thread options available, otherwise, the red heart may lack definition against the dark background.

Practical Embroidery Notes for Success

To ensure that your final product matches the quality of your marketing materials, follow these essential steps before running large orders:

  1. Test on Scrap Fabric: Never run a new design directly onto your inventory. Stitch the border on scraps of the exact fabric you plan to sell. This reveals how the material reacts to the needle and thread.
  2. Check Thread Color Contrast: Verify that the chosen thread colors stand out against your specific fabric. Test both light and dark fabric mockups to see how the red heart appears under different lighting conditions.
  3. Confirm Hoop Size and Stability: Ensure your hoop is large enough to accommodate the full width of the border. Use the appropriate stabilizer—cut-away for stretchy knits and tear-away for wovens—to maintain structure.
  4. Review Stitch Density: Look closely at the stitch density in the heart centers. If it is too dense, it may create a stiff, cardboard-like feel on soft fabrics like baby blankets. If it is too sparse, it may show the backing through the stitches.
  5. Commercial Licensing: Before selling any finished products, confirm the commercial licensing terms of the digital embroidery file. Some designs allow unlimited sales, while others restrict the number of units or require specific attribution.
